Transaction 8bb3095ca6cdebaf8a9f4e8156d6b3e4daa9c996fc7de1497361909c4c540107
1 Input
2 Outputs
- 8bb3095ca6cdebaf8a9f4e8156d6b3e4daa9c996fc7de1497361909c4c540107:0
- 8bb3095ca6cdebaf8a9f4e8156d6b3e4daa9c996fc7de1497361909c4c540107:1
value 27013407
address 1AMeVeLp9FUpQH6XcCfVm6PxZgy4BNQS5D
value 4805439
address bc1qphpa3salrjnthqygk5f224zphunj5rfkspsfem